February 2025 Release.

Traces

  • Deprecate exception.escaped attribute, add link to in-development semantic-conventions
    on how to record errors across signals.
    (#4368)
  • Define randomness value requirements for W3C Trace Context Level 2.
    (#4162)

Logs

  • Define how SDK implements Logger.Enabled.
    (#4381)
  • Logs API should have functionality for reusing Standard Attributes.
    (#4373)

SDK Configuration

  • Define syntax for escaping declarative configuration environment variable
    references.
    (#4375)
  • Resolve various declarative config TODOs.
    (#4394)
